These calls will not be processed by FW anyway, but error handling on sysfs level should be improved. == Changes == This patch prohibits performing of all set commands in SRIOV mode on sysfs level. It offers better error handling as calls that are not allowed will not be propagated further. == Test == Writing to any sysfs file in passthrough mode will succeed. Writing to any sysfs file in ONEVF mode will yield error: "calling process does not have sufficient permission to execute a command".
